Abstract
To deny that advances in health delivery and research, including therapeutic medicines during the past sixty years, have not been of significant benefit to mankind is to deny reality. Equally, few will be prepared to deny that the future will be one of at least equal promise. Children will be born with their genes profiled, personalized medicines will be a reality, gene and stem cell therapies will be mature disciplines with major implications for the degenerative disorders of an aging world. This new world will be one of artificial cells and machines, many specifically created de novo with an expanded genetic code and that will execute unique tasks ranging from the site- and disease-specific delivery of drugs, genes, and gene repair instructions to neuronal- and DNA-based computers. These advances will have been made possible by a remarkable several generations of scientific research, culminating in the reading of multiple genomes, including the human genome.
